The cornerstone of a successful import project is rigorous supplier verification. Moving beyond basic Alibaba listings is paramount. Start by defining your project’s precise requirements: mold life expectancy, material (e.g., P20, H13 steel), cavity count, and tolerance levels. Use this specification sheet to screen potential China mold factory partners. Prioritize suppliers with proven experience in your industry, whether automotive, medical, consumer electronics, or packaging. Scrutinize their portfolio for projects of similar complexity. Essential verification steps include a detailed audit of their business license, factory ownership, and export history. In 2026, leverage technology: request virtual factory tours via video call to inspect machinery (e.g., CNC, EDM, CMM), workshop organization, and cleanliness. Always ask for and contact 2-3 verifiable overseas references. This due diligence phase, though time-consuming, is your primary risk mitigation tool.
Once a shortlist is established, mastering the technical and commercial negotiation phase is critical. A professional mold factory china will treat the Request for Quotation (RFQ) process seriously. Provide comprehensive 3D part files (STEP or IGES) and 2D drawings with clear, standardized geometric dimensioning and tolerancing (GD&T). Expect detailed quotations that break down costs for mold design, material, machining, heat treatment, trial shots, and shipping. Be wary of suspiciously low bids; they often signal corner-cutting on steel quality or post-sales support. Negotiate key contractual terms upfront: payment schedule (e.g., 30-50% deposit, balance before shipment), intellectual property protection clauses, and most importantly, a clear, milestone-based project timeline with defined responsibilities for design reviews and approvals. This clarity prevents misunderstandings that can lead to costly delays.
Implementing a proactive, multi-stage quality control protocol is non-negotiable. The era of “blind faith” shipping is over. For overseas buyers, quality control must be designed into the procurement process. Insist on a Design for Manufacturability (DFM) report before machining begins. A competent supplier will analyze your part design, suggest improvements for moldability, and confirm steel selection and cooling channel layout. The critical physical inspection points are: First Article Inspection (FAI) after the mold is machined, using CMM reports to verify core and cavity dimensions against your drawings, and the Trial Run Report. Never approve mass production without receiving sample parts, video of the trial run, and a full data pack including process parameters. For high-value or high-volume projects, engaging a local third-party quality inspection firm for these key milestones provides an objective, expert layer of oversight and is a highly recommended investment.
Managing logistics and fostering a long-term partnership are the final, crucial steps. Understand Incoterms 2026 clearly—FOB is common, but you must arrange freight forwarding and insurance. Ensure the supplier provides a professional commercial invoice, packing list, and certificate of origin. For injection mold tools, proper packaging (waterproof, shock-absorbent) is vital to prevent rust and damage in transit. Upon receipt, conduct your own immediate inspection. A reliable partner will offer a reasonable warranty period (typically 12-24 months) covering workmanship and material defects. View this initial project as the foundation for a strategic partnership. Clear communication, documented processes, and fair dealings build trust. A successful long-term relationship with a verified Chinese mold manufacturer translates to faster turnaround times, priority service, and continuous improvement on future projects, maximizing your return on investment.
